Why These Are the Top Home Security Contractors in Weatherby

** The home security market serving Weatherby, Missouri, is characterized by regional and local providers due to the village's small size. Residents do not have the option of a hyper-local Weatherby-based company but are served effectively by established businesses in St. Joseph (approx. 30 minutes away) and Cameron (approx. 15 minutes away). The competition is moderate, with a mix of one national brand (ADT) via a local dealer and several strong, reputable local integrators. The average quality is high, as these companies have built their reputations by serving rural and small-town communities across northwestern Missouri. Typical pricing for a basic monitored system starts around $35-$50 per month, with upfront equipment and installation costs ranging from $0 (with certain contracts) to $1,500+ for more advanced, customized systems with cameras and smart home integration. Customers in this area highly value reliability, responsive local service, and companies that stand behind their work, which the providers listed above consistently deliver.

Frequently Asked Questions About Home Security in Weatherby

Get answers to common questions about home security services in Weatherby, Missouri.

1What is the typical cost for a professionally installed home security system in Weatherby, and are there any local factors that affect pricing?

In the Weatherby area, a basic professionally installed system typically starts between $200-$600 for equipment and installation, with a monthly monitoring fee of $30-$60. Local factors include the need for cellular-based monitoring (as reliable landline service can be sparse in rural parts of DeKalb County) and the potential for discounts through local utility co-ops or affiliations. Missouri's state sales tax of 4.225% plus any local county taxes will also apply to equipment purchases.

2How does Missouri's climate, particularly severe weather in the spring and summer, impact home security system choices for Weatherby residents?

Weatherby's location in Northwest Missouri means systems must be resilient against severe thunderstorms, high winds, hail, and potential tornadoes prevalent from spring through summer. It's crucial to choose equipment with a strong weatherproof rating for outdoor cameras and sensors, and to ensure your system has a battery backup that lasts through frequent power outages. Many local homeowners prioritize systems that integrate severe weather alerts alongside security monitoring.

4What should I look for when choosing a local security provider versus a large national company in the Weatherby area?

For Weatherby's rural setting, a key consideration is the provider's ability to service and respond in DeKalb County. Local or regional providers often have faster on-site support and understand specific challenges like longer emergency response times, property layouts common to the area, and cellular signal strengths. National companies may offer more advanced smart home integrations. Always verify local customer references and ask about their experience with service calls to farms or properties on the outskirts of town.

5With many homes on larger lots or in rural settings near Weatherby, what are the best security solutions for monitoring outbuildings and property perimeters?

For securing barns, workshops, and extensive property lines common in the area, a combination of wireless, battery-powered motion-activated cameras and outdoor motion-sensor lighting is highly effective. Look for systems with long-range wireless sensors and cellular backup to ensure coverage across your property. Given the local wildlife, choose cameras and sensors with pet-immunity or adjustable sensitivity to reduce false alarms from deer or other animals, and consider solar-powered options for remote locations.
